The blurb on us re 2013/14 was chillingly spot on, but we will be a different beast this year. We are still hopeful that Davie Anderson will hear the call and be back, phoenix-style, to lead us to greatness (or at least ninth), but no sign of that yet. We were truly awful last year but fans of other sides seem to have dismissed how unremittingly bad everyone else in the division was. Peterhead were a shadow of their former selves, yet won the league quite comfortably. Annan were a wee bit better than usual, but not a good side, and Stirling will have a hard shift in a higher division unless they sort themselves out. Everyone else was fairly gash last year.

We were pretty awful against Berwick in the Petrofac, with several players making their senior debuts and the team nowhere near settled, but they couldn't beat us over 120 minutes, about half of it with 10 men, and we had a perfectly good goal chalked off. We'll get much better and it won't take much to be better than at least one other side in the division.
